delphi常用快捷键,我自己经常使用的

代码编辑器:
Home                                    回到当前行的头部
End                                     回到当前行的尾部
Insert                                  插入代码,覆盖后面的代码,(按回车无效), 再按撤回效果
Delete                                  删除
F1                                      双击一个单词后,按F1调用自带的Library 参考函数引用单元及用法
F2                                      在Project上可重命名
Ctrl + Home                       回到代码头部
Ctrl + End                        回到代码底部
Ctrl + Tab                              切换代码页
Ctrl + Shift + U                  选中行左移Tab键(兼容) 
Ctrl + Tab                              选中行左移Tab键(XE里可以用,D7无效)
Ctrl + Shift + I                  选中行右移,相当于Tab键
Tab                                  选中行右移Tab键(XE里可以用)  
Ctrl + Shift + C                  声明函数或过程后,自动添加代码 (可反向)
Ctrl + A                                        全选      
Ctrl + C                                        复制      
Ctrl + X                                        剪切      
Ctrl + V                                        粘贴      
Ctrl + S                                        保存      
Ctrl + F                                        查找 (按F3继续查找下个目标)
Ctrl + Y                删除行
Ctrl + D                代码按默认格式编排(在安装时没勾选就没有)
Ctrl + K + W                    将文本块写入文件        
Ctrl + K + R                    读入文本块   
Ctrl + K + C                    文本再制    
Ctrl + K + N                    代码转大写   
Ctrl + K + O                    代码转小写   
Ctrl + K + F                    代码转大写, 并取消选择    
Ctrl + K + E                    代码转小写, 并取消选择    
Ctrl + O + U                    改变光标后面的字母大小写    

编译类:
F4                              运行到光标位置         
F5                              设置/取消断点  (或鼠标点击断点)
F7                              调试,进入子过程        
F8                              调试,不进子过程(除非有断点)         
F9                              运行,若有断点,则会跳到断点处 (单步运行时:将鼠标点击断点位置可运行到断点位置)
Ctrl + F9                       编译工程    
Ctrl + O + O                    插入编译选项

组件类:
Esc                       选择当前组件容器      
Shift + Click          选择多个组件;选择窗体      
Tab                       选择下一个组件       
Shift + Tab               选择上一个组件       
Ctrl  + 方向键            将所选组件的位置移动 1 个像素         
Shift + 方向键            将所选组件的大小改变 1 个像素         
Ctrl  + Shift + 方向键       将所选组件的位置移动 1 个栅格      
Del                       删除所选组件        
Ctrl  + 鼠标拖动           选择一个容器内的多个组件     可以一起修改共同属性
Ctrl  + A                  选择全部组件
Shift + 组件            当需要放很多同一组件时,可按住Shift鼠标点击面板增加组件(取消方法一样)